2023 Kia Telluride exterior updates 

For 2023, the Kia Telluride comes with additional trim levels, fresh styling, and new features inside out. It now has redesigned headlights featuring standard LEDs with optional LED fog lamps. While the new front bumper looks bolder than before, the tiger-nose grille balances its sporty and classy look. Thanks to its state-of-the-art rear bumper and taillight inserts with sleek vertical LED strips, it now has a more streamlined rear. Moreover, it comes with a new 18-20-inch wheel design and three new exterior paint color options, including Midnight Lake Blue, Jungle Wood Green, and Dawning Red.
